2027 UCI Cycling World Championships Haute-Savoie Mont-Blanc

Making Cycling History

From 24 August to 5 September 2027, Haute-Savoie Mont-Blanc will host the 2027 UCI Cycling World Championships – the largest cycling event ever staged.

Over 13 days, more than 15,000 athletes from around the world will compete for 288 UCI World titles across 20 UCI World Championships held at 15 competition venues, showcasing a remarkable range of disciplines including Road, Para-cycling, Mountain Bike, BMX, Track, Gravel, Indoor Cycling and many more.

Following Glasgow in 2023, Haute-Savoie Mont-Blanc will host the second edition of the UCI Cycling World Championships in an even more ambitious format. From the shores of Lake Annecy to the peaks of Mont Blanc, the world's greatest cyclists will compete across an exceptional landscape, offering a unique spectacle for both dedicated fans and the wider public.

Designed as a truly inclusive event, the 2027 UCI Cycling World Championships will place inclusion, sharing and accessibility at the heart of the project. Reflecting this ambition, the ticketing programme has been designed to enable as many people as possible to experience the Championships, with nearly 90% of competitions freely accessible to spectators.

Beyond the sporting performances, the Championships will leave a lasting legacy for cycling participation while showcasing the outstanding landscapes, culture and heritage of Haute-Savoie through an event of international significance.
